Engine Overheating (LM2)
| Step | Action | Yes | No |
|---|---|---|---|
| DEFINITION: The engine temperature lamp comes on and stays on, or temperature gauge shows hot, or a Diagnostic Trouble Code (DTC) is set, or coolant overflows from the surge tank onto the ground while the engine is running. | |||
| 1 | Check for any Diagnostic Trouble Codes (DTC). Are there any Diagnostic Trouble Codes (DTC) present? |
Refer to the appropriate Diagnostic Trouble Codes (DTC). Diagnostic Trouble Code (DTC) List - Vehicle | Go to Step 2 |
| 2 | Check for a loss of coolant. Loss of Coolant Is there a loss of coolant? |
Go to Step 3 | Go to Step 4 |
| 3 | Fill the system to the specified level. Cooling System Draining and Filling (GE 47716 L84, L87)Cooling System Draining and Filling (Static L84, L87)Cooling System Draining and Filling (Static LM2)Cooling System Draining and Filling (GE 47716 LM2) Does the engine still overheat? |
Go to Step 4 | System OK |
| 4 | Check for kinked or pinched surge tank hoses, especially at the radiator. Are any surge tank hoses kinked or pinched? |
Go to Step 5 | Go to Step 6 |

| 6 | Check for loose, missing, or damaged radiator air seals or deflectors. Are there any loose, missing, or damaged radiator air seals or deflectors? |
Go to Step 7 | Go to Step 8 |
| 7 | Repair or replace any loose, missing, or damaged radiator air seals or deflectors. Does the engine still overheat? |
Go to Step 8 | System OK |
| 8 | Check the coolant concentration. Does the coolant concentration test correctly? |
Go to Step 10 | Go to Step 9 |
| 9 | Replace the coolant, if necessary. Cooling System Draining and Filling (GE 47716 L84, L87)Cooling System Draining and Filling (Static L84, L87)Cooling System Draining and Filling (Static LM2)Cooling System Draining and Filling (GE 47716 LM2) Does the engine still overheat? |
Go to Step 10 | System OK |

| 16 | Check for an inoperative cooling fan. Is the cooling fan inoperative? |
Go to Step 17 | Go to Step 18 |
| 17 | Replace the cooling fan. Engine Cooling Fan Motor Replacement (L84, L87)Engine Cooling Fan Motor Replacement (LM2) Does the engine still overheat? |
Go to Step 18 | System OK |
| 18 | Check for a faulty water pump. The impeller blades may be eroded or broken. Is the water pump faulty? |
Go to Step 19 | - |
| 19 | Replace the water pump. Water Pump Replacement (L84, L87)Water Pump Replacement (LM2) Does the engine still overheat? |
- | System OK |
